Design and implementation of PFM mode high efficiency boost regulator

Abstract: This paper presents the design and implementation of a low voltage DC-DC asynchronous boost regulator that works in PFM (pulse frequency modulation) mode. The booster is designed to supply low load condition of up to 20 mA with high efficiency. The total bias current of the chip is only 5 lA when operating with 1 mA load and the number goes to maximum of 18 lA with maximum load condition of 20 mA.
